The book "Supporting Gifted Students in Everyday School Life" by Stephan Petry offers a practical guide for promoting highly gifted students in regular schools. Often, the focus in school life is on underperforming students, which causes the individual talents of other learners to be overlooked. This work highlights the necessity of creating structures that enable targeted support. It demonstrates how gifted students can be supported according to their abilities and integrated into regular classes. The guide provides valuable strategies for differentiation and individual support to unlock the potential of these students and to prevent behavioral issues and school failure.
